HRSA's Award Process for Zika Response and Preparedness Funds

The Zika Response and Preparedness Appropriations Act, 2016 (P.L. 114-223, Division B, September 29, 2016), provided to HRSA $66 million in funding to remain available until September 30, 2017. The funding was to be directed at efforts in Puerto Rico and other territories to (1) expand the delivery of primary health care services; (2) support public health departments and entities, with the goal of ensuring access to recommended services for pregnant women, infants, and children; and (3) make loan repayment awards to National Health Service Corps members providing primary health services. We will determine whether HRSA awarded these funds during fiscal year 2017 in compliance with Federal regulations and HHS grant policies.
